First Filing and Paperwork



When launching divorce procedures, the first step usually includes submitting the essential documents with the ideal court. This paperwork usually includes a petition or issue for separation, which describes the factors for the separation and any requests for youngster wardship, assistance, or department of possessions.

You'll require to gather vital files such as marital relationship certificates, monetary records, and any kind of relevant contracts or prenuptial contracts.

Once the paperwork is submitted, you'll need to guarantee that your partner is correctly served with the divorce papers. This can be done through a process-server or certified mail, depending upon the requirements of your territory.

After your spouse has actually been served, they'll have a particular quantity of time to respond to the request.

Court Appearances and Procedures



On a regular basis, browsing court looks and procedures throughout separation can be an overwhelming process. As soon as your separation case is submitted, you might be called for to attend numerous court appearances. These looks can include hearings associated with momentary orders, settlement meetings, and inevitably, the trial. It's essential to familiarize on your own with the details procedures and policies of the court where your case is being listened to. Ensure to dress properly for court, arrive on time, and perform yourself respectfully.

During court appearances, you may require to resolve the judge directly, so it's crucial to talk clearly and confidently.



Recognizing court treatments is crucial to ensure that your case proceeds smoothly. Before each court appearance, examine any essential documentation and prepare any kind of records or evidence required. Additionally, be prepared to respond to inquiries from the judge or your attorney. It's important to comply with any type of instructions offered by the court and follow target dates for submitting paperwork.

Final Judgment and End Results



Obtaining a last judgment in a separation case notes a significant landmark in the legal process. This judgment represents the main end of the marriage and details the final decisions made by the court relating to vital concerns such as department of properties, youngster custody, visitation legal rights, and financial backing. The final judgment is lawfully binding and requires both parties to follow its terms.

In divorce cases, results can vary commonly based upon the specifics of each situation and the choices made by the court. The final judgment may lead to a variety of outcomes, including one event being awarded main custody of the youngsters, the division of building and properties, and the decision of spousal support or child assistance settlements. It's vital to carefully examine the final judgment to recognize your rights and obligations moving on.

Eventually, the last judgment in a separation case aims to give a reasonable and equitable resolution to the problems available, allowing both parties to move on with their lives independently.
